The Installation Process: What to Expect
The process of back entrance installation typically involves a number of actions:
- Consultation: Homeowners discuss their needs and choices with the installer.
- Measurement: The installer takes precise measurements to make sure the brand-new door fits correctly.
- Material Selection: Homeowners choose materials based upon spending plan, aesthetics, and energy performance.
- Preparation: The existing door and frame may require to be removed, requiring mindful handling to prevent residential or commercial property damage.
- Installation: The brand-new door is hung and protected, with changes made for ideal efficiency.
- Ending up Touches: Weather removing and seals are applied, locks are installed, and any necessary trims are completed.

4. How do I keep my back door?
Routine upkeep strategies include:
- Inspecting weather removing and seals for wear.
- Cleaning up the door surface area and hardware.
- Examining the positioning to avoid sticking.
- Applying paint or sealant as required.
5. What are some indications that I should change my back door?
Signs include:
- Difficulty opening or closing the door.
- Visible drafts or water leaks.
- Visible damage, such as fractures or decomposing.
- Outdated aesthetic appeals that do not match your home's style.
